[Physical activity level and home blood pressure measurement: Pilot study "Acti-HTA"]
P Sosner1, J Ott2, O Steichen3
1Centre médico-sportif Mon Stade, 5, rue Elsa-Morante, 75013 Paris, France; Laboratoire MOVE (EA6314), université de Poitiers, 8, allée Jean-Monnet, 86000 Poitiers, France; Centre de diagnostic, Hôtel-Dieu, AP-HP, 1, parvis Notre-Dame, 75004 Paris, France.
Abstract:
While physical activity (PA) is recommended for high blood pressure management, the level of PA practice of hypertensive patients remains unclear. We aimed to assess the association between the level of both PA and blood pressure of individuals consulting in 9 hypertension specialist centres. Eighty-five hypertensive patients were included (59 ± 14 years, 61% men, 12% smokers, 29% with diabetes). Following their consultation, they performed home blood pressure measurement (HBPM) over 7 days (2 in the morning+2 in the evening), they wrote in a dedicated form their daily activities to estimate the additional caloric expenditure using Acti-MET device (built from International physical Activity Questionnaire [IPAQ]). Thus, patients completed a self-administered questionnaire "score of Dijon" (distinguishing active subjects with a score>20/30, from sedentary<10/30). Subjects with normal HBPM value (<135/85 mm Hg) (55% of them) compared to those with high HBPM were older, had a non-significant trend towards higher weekly caloric expenditure (4959 ± 5045 kcal/week vs. 4048 ± 4199 kcal/week, P=0.3755) and score of Dijon (19.44 ± 5.81 vs. 18.00 ± 4.32, P=0.2094) with a higher proportion of "active" subjects (48.9% vs. 34.2%, P=0.1773). In conclusion, our results demonstrate a "tendency" to a higher level of reported PA for subjects whose hypertension was controlled. This encourages us to continue with a study that would include more subjects, which would assess PA level using an objective method such as wearing an accelerometer sensor.

Special considerations while measuring blood pressure
Monitoring Both Arms:
Monitoring BP in both arms during the initial assessment is advisable, as the systolic value may differ by five to ten mm Hg between arms. For subsequent BP assessments, use the arm with the higher reading.
